Through hands-on experience with real problems, students will learn
computing skills essential in applied statistics and in research in
methodological and theoretical statistics. Topics include the Linux operating
system; R and SAS (statistical computing environments); LATEX (mathematical
document preparation language); reproducible research; database management;
WinBUGS (software for fitting Bayesian models); simulation methods (Monte Carlo studies, bootstrap, MCMC); statistical computing algorithms (Newton's method,
EM algorithm); interfacing to cyberinfrastructure resources.
